With that, here is a look at some of the new and revamped food and beverage options inside and around Truist Field for the 2021 season.
DEACTOWN Fan Zone presented by Forsyth County Farm Bureau Insurance
Before Opening Night at Truist Field on Sept. 3 presented by Lowes Foods, generations of Demon Deacon families and all Triad and North Carolina football fans can enjoy live music by Winston-Salem native, Cinnamon Reggae, food trucks including Wings-N-Fins, Curbing Your Appetite, Village Juice Company, Clutch Coffee, and more. The space will also feature a dedicated beer garden featuring the Lowes Foods Beer Den, a 21ft wide video wall to watch games from across the country, and the opportunity to enjoy live music, giveaways and more.
Festivities begin three hours prior to each home game at this new and expanded space located on the lawn outside McCreary Tower. This is a great destination for all fans - whether you seek a premium tailgating experience at the DEACTOWN Tailgate Village, or simply want the opportunity to enjoy live music, video screens, local drink options, fun and a variety of food trucks.
The DEACTOWN Fan Zone will be a destination for families, featuring giveaways, inflatable games, balloon artists and face painting. Officially licensed Wake Forest merchandise from a variety of best-in-class brands will be available for purchase at the on-site Deacon Shop.
In addition once everyone arrives inside Truist Field, fans will have the option of new concessions options and an improved fan experience during the game.
Seven Saturdays Bar, Presented by R&D Brewing
An all new experience will be introduced in the south endzone of Truist Field this season as the Seven Saturdays Bar takes its place below the Bob McCreary Video Board Honoring the Class of 1961.
This space will be open to fans with any ticket location and will feature three dedicated bars serving R&D Brewing's premier beverages, including the new Deacon Brew refreshing light beer.
Fans inside this space will be able to watch other games around the country on six TV screens, while enjoying a variety of seating and standing-room options to cheer on the Demon Deacons.
New and Expanded Food Truck Offerings
Food options continue to expand at Truist Field with new offerings available this year through the stadium. Food trucks will be available in two locations around Truist Field - the south end zone concourse near the Seven Saturdays Bar, and the east stadium concourse.
Food truck partners inside Truist Field include, Damn Good Dogs, Big Apes, You Drive Me Crepe-z, Scoop Zone, Kona Ice, Boho Berries (acai bowls), Innovative Concessions, Henry's Kettle Corn, Frios Gourmet Pops, Lowes Foods Beer Den, and more!
Broad Branch Distillery in Flow Lexus Club
Wake Forest has partnered with prominent local distillery, Broad Branch, to elevate the experience for all premium ticket holders within the Flow Lexus Club. Ticket holders in this space will now have the opportunity to enjoy the wide array of distilled spirits made daily in Broad Branch's Trade Street location.
Specialty cocktails will also be crafted by the distillers at Broad Branch for each game, available for purchase exclusively at the two Broad Branch bars in this space.
